So, anyways, usually I just tie it up in a boring ponytail, but I’ve got to say I’m totally digging the whole side braids trend, inspired by Alexander Wang‘s and Miu Miu‘s Spring/Summer 2010 show. I’ve tried it a couple times and it’s just super fast and easy. Just pump up the volume of your hair, part it anyway you like, toss all of your hair over your shoulder and braid it loosely. Voila, you’re done! And don’t bother starting over if it’s not neat or if you have a couple strands falling out, because that’s how it’s meant to be! The messier, the better. Alternatively, you can also go the Rachel McAdams way, and do major teasing at your crown before braiding. The side braid is fast becoming my go-to hairstyle, especially when it’s really windy out. It keeps my hair in place and saves me from the horror of detangling, later on. Not to mention, how it’s my saving grace for bad hair days! This style is functional, effortless and flirty. I’m so glad I have long hair to pull this off.
